What Is This
A trust agreement is the instrument creating a trust and naming its settlor, trustee, and beneficiaries, and at closing it establishes whether the trustee may borrow against and pledge trust property being taken as collateral.

Certification of trust delivered in place of the full instrument routinely omits the borrowing and encumbrance clause the closing table needs to read
Co-trustee provisions can require two signatures where only one trustee shows up to sign
